GENERAL CONCEPTS OF THE CONGENITAL ARTERIOVENOUS FISTULA

The arteriovenous fistula is an anomalous connection between an artery and a vein. Blood flows directly from an artery to a vein without reaching the capillary circulation. THE CAUDAL REGRESSION SYNDROME: MORE COMMON CAUSES AND ANOMALIES.

The caudal regression syndrome was described by Duhamel in 1961. It is about a congenital malformation related to visceral anomalies with a different affectation degree. The anomalies are of a skeletal muscle, gastrointestinal, neurological, genitourinary and cardiac kind.
